Puncak Menara is a privatised project undertaken by several national leaders jointly with malay cooporate officer, Encik Syed Musa Ali bin Haji Mohd Amin . Since its privatisation in November 1984, Puncak Menara Holding has successfully developed more than one third of the total 456 acres township into various residential, industrial and commercial properties under Phase 1 & 2.

Puncak Menara reigns as Penang's most ambilitious and advanced development to date.

This mega RM 3.0 Billion (US $630 Million) development, strategically unfold over a 456 acres (186 hectares) of prime land, conceptualized as a self-contained township, where work and live under one roof.

This area is easily accessible to airport, seaport, railway and highways. It is located mere 20-30 minutes drive away from Penang International Airport and about 2 km away from Penang Bridge Interchange. The township is well served by an excellent road network system

Inspired by the success of the Fisherman's Wharf in Gold Coast, Australia and our local experience at Bangsar in Kuala Lumpur, the Food Beverage & Entertainment Centre is conceived to satisfy the increasingly large numbers of young professionals and expatriates working and living in the surrounding industrial parks and housing estates. However, unlike Bangsar, the Centre is purpose-built with ample parking bays and specially designed pedestrian walkways that provide a conducive atmosphere for an evening of leisure and entertainment for the whole family as well as the yuppies. It will also appeal to tourists.The centre comprises four rows of shops linked by a common pedestrian walk away that is traffic free.
